The Scientific Revolution

Ptolemy

Science is a particular way of gaining knowledge about the world. Science comes from the Latin word that means "knowledge." In science to start a new theory you must start with a observation. Once you have made your observations you should start your experiments. Then end your theory.

The Scientific Revolution was a series of events that led to the birth of modern science. The Scientific Revolution occurred between about 1540 and 1700. The Scientific Revolution started because many people were interested in science.

Theories

Theories are the explanations scientists develop based on facts.
Theories always had to be proven for them to be true. Theories have have been developed for centuries.
All theories are tested to see if they are true.

Ptolemy was another greek thinker and astronomer. Ptolemy was also a geographer who made the best maps of his time. Ptolemy recorded his observations and did theories to prove his hypothieses
